使用PBFunc在Powerbuilder中支付宝当面付款功能
Powerbuilder中的支付宝当面付款功能:PBFunc的实现之道
在Powerbuilder中实现支付宝的当面付款功能,是许多开发者关注的焦点。此功能不仅提升了支付的便捷性,还为商户提供了更多的交易机会。本文将带你深入了解如何使用PBFunc在Powerbuilder中完美集成支付宝的当面付款功能。
要实现这一功能,你需要在支付宝平台上进行商户签约。这是确保你的应用能够安全、顺畅地与支付宝平台交互的关键步骤。在完成签约后,你需要设置相关的公钥信息。这些信息是保障交易安全的重要组成部分,具体的设置方法可以参考支付宝官方文档。
在完成商户签约和公钥设置后,你需要使用对应的私钥文件进行参数的计算。这里,RSAWithSha1加密技术将起到关键作用。通过这种技术,你可以确保交易数据的机密性和完整性,防止数据在传输过程中被篡改。
在PBFunc中,你需要编写相应的代码来实现与支付宝平台的交互。这个过程涉及到多个步骤,包括生成订单、发起支付请求、处理支付结果等。每个步骤都需要精细的设计和实现,以确保功能的稳定性和安全性。
你还需要关注用户体验。在集成支付宝当面付款功能时,应尽可能简化操作流程,提高支付的便捷性。你还需要处理可能出现的异常情况,如网络故障、支付失败等,以确保用户在使用过程中的体验。
使用PBFunc在Powerbuilder中实现支付宝当面付款功能是一项具有挑战性的任务,但只要你掌握了相关的技术和方法,就能够轻松应对。这个功能将为你带来更高的交易效率和更多的商机,是值得一投入的项目。
希望本文能为你提供有价值的参考,如果你有任何疑问或需要进一步的帮助,欢迎随时与我们联系。让我们共同Powerbuilder与支付宝的完美结合,为你的应用带来更多的可能性。使用PBFunc在PowerBuilder中实现支付宝当面付款功能
在PowerBuilder中,使用PBFunc进行支付宝的当面付款是一个复杂但极为重要的功能。下面,我们将详细介绍这一过程,并特别关注代码的实现。
我们需要定义一些必要的变量,如私钥文件名、应用ID、交易内容等。私钥文件用于生成签名,确保交易的安全性。应用ID是我们在支付宝开放平台上申请的唯一标识。交易内容则包含了交易的主要信息,如交易号、场景、授权码、主题和总金额等。
接下来,我们利用PBFunc的加密功能,对请求参数进行UTF-8编码和SHA1withRSA签名。如果签名成功,我们会弹出一个提示框显示签名结果。这一步非常重要,因为签名保证了请求的真实性和完整性。
验证签名过程同样重要。我们使用公钥文件对签名进行验证,确保请求是由合法的发送方发出的。验证成功后,我们会再次弹出提示框。
然后,我们将所有的请求参数组合成一个字符串,并通过HTTP协议发送给支付宝的开放API。这一步需要使用PBFunc的HTTP功能,清空之前的参数,然后设置URL并发送请求。如果请求成功,我们会接收到支付宝的响应数据,这些数据是UTF-8编码的,我们需要将其转换为GBK编码以正常显示。如果转换成功,我们会弹出一个提示框显示响应数据和原始数据。如果请求失败,我们也会弹出相应的提示框。
我们还提供了一个辅助函数wf_alipay_urlencode,用于对请求参数进行URL编码。这是为了确保参数在传输过程中的正确性。
这就是在PowerBuilder中使用PBFunc实现支付宝当面付款功能的全过程。这个过程涉及到编码、签名、验证、HTTP请求等多个环节,需要仔细处理每个细节以确保功能的正确性。
我们希望这篇文章能对大家有所帮助。如果你有任何疑问或需要进一步的解释,请随时留言。我们会及时回复,并尽力解答你的问题。长沙网络推广团队将一直关注并支持你的学习和进步。在这个过程中,安全和准确性是最重要的,所以在实现这些功能时一定要小心谨慎。在浩瀚的宇宙间,有一个神秘而令人着迷的地方,那里是时间的深渊,生命的起源地——Cambrian。此刻,让我们一起领略Cambrian的独特魅力,感受其深邃的韵味。
在这充满奇幻色彩的Cambrian世界里,每一次呈现都如同生命的绽放,充满了活力和魅力。当渲染引擎启动,将内容注入至名为“body”的载体时,我们仿佛置身于一个五彩斑斓的画卷之中。在这里,每一个细节都经过精心雕琢,每一处风景都让人流连忘返。
随着视线的深入,我们仿佛穿越时空,来到了遥远的古时代。那时的Cambrian海洋,是一片生机勃勃的天地。无数的生物在这里诞生、成长、繁衍,共同谱写了一曲生命的赞歌。在这里,你可以感受到生命的蓬勃与活力,仿佛置身于一个生命的交响乐中。
而在现代,Cambrian仍然保持着那份神秘与魅力。科技的力量在这里得到了充分的体现,让人们对这片神奇的土地有了更深入的了解。随着研究的深入,我们不断发现新的奥秘和惊喜。这里的每一片石头、每一滴水都在诉说着古老的故事,引领我们走进一个神秘的世界。
在Cambrian的世界里,无论是古老的海洋时代还是现代的科技时代,都充满了无尽的魅力。这里既有古老的神秘感,又有现代的科技感。在这里,我们可以感受到生命的蓬勃与活力,也可以感受到科技的无限可能。这里是一个充满奇幻色彩的世界,让人陶醉其中,流连忘返。
Cambrian是一个令人着迷的地方。在这里,我们可以感受到生命的起源与演变,也可以感受到科技的无限魅力。让我们一起走进Cambrian的世界,感受其深邃的韵味和无尽的魅力吧!
长沙网站设计
- 使用PBFunc在Powerbuilder中支付宝当面付款功能
- ASP.NET MVC5验证系列之Fluent Validation
- jQuery实现二级下拉菜单效果
- 详解通过源码解析Node.js中cluster模块的主要功能实
- php+ajax实现无刷新分页
- MySQL密码正确却无法本地登录-1045
- 浅谈 vue 中的 watcher
- ASP生成柱型体,折线图,饼图源代码
- JS给Textarea文本框添加行号的方法
- 仿淘宝JSsearch搜索下拉深度用法
- JavaScript+html5 canvas绘制的小人效果
- js实现分享到随页面滚动而滑动效果的方法
- JS 正则表达式验证密码、邮箱格式的实例代码
- php 中phar包的使用教程详解
- javascript实现数组去重的多种方法
- php+redis实现注册、删除、编辑、分页、登录、关